Is 646 781 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 646 781 is about 804.227.

Thus, the square root of 646 781 is not an integer, and therefore 646 781 is not a square number.

Anyway, 646 781 is a prime number, and a prime number cannot be a perfect square.

What is the square number of 646 781?

The square of a number (here 646 781) is the result of the product of this number (646 781) by itself (i.e., 646 781 × 646 781); the square of 646 781 is sometimes called "raising 646 781 to the power 2", or "646 781 squared".

The square of 646 781 is 418 325 661 961 because 646 781 × 646 781 = 646 7812 = 418 325 661 961.

As a consequence, 646 781 is the square root of 418 325 661 961.
